It does look odd with the extra end panel on the corner unit.
Having end panels on the normal units does mean the kkckboards are doddle to fit as they are just a straight cut. If you don't have end panels then you'd have to mitre the corners. Not a big deal but it is a different look. The end panels also cover the variation in your walls, you scribe the panels to pit the wall. You can do this with the units on their own but can be tricky. |
